Output 8bf3d9ae7fc0ae32ab4daf00567b59ead3b0e50225adb5c37cb75a1d25b20864:1

value
2630770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f5430f3b0a15c27fe2c7bc69b95da360b2 OP_EQUAL
address
3BMEX6RGABt5JumvRXXXjnDNgcf9CeuYzu
transaction
8bf3d9ae7fc0ae32ab4daf00567b59ead3b0e50225adb5c37cb75a1d25b20864
spent
true